Here is a list of all documented functions, variables, defines, enums, and typedefs with links to the documentation:
- s -
- sample_ptr_t : samplebuffer.h
- samplebuffer_append() : samplebuffer.c, samplebuffer.h
- samplebuffer_close() : samplebuffer.c, samplebuffer.h
- samplebuffer_discard() : samplebuffer.c, samplebuffer.h
- samplebuffer_flush() : samplebuffer.c, samplebuffer.h
- samplebuffer_get() : samplebuffer.c, samplebuffer.h
- samplebuffer_init() : samplebuffer.c, samplebuffer.h
- samplebuffer_set_bps() : samplebuffer.c, samplebuffer.h
- samplebuffer_set_waveform() : samplebuffer.c, samplebuffer.h
- SAMPLES_BPS_SHIFT : samplebuffer.h
- SAMPLES_PTR : samplebuffer.h
- SAMPLES_PTR_MAKE : samplebuffer.h
- SBITS : rdpq_debug.c
- sbrk() : system.c
- SECTOR_PAYLOAD : dfsinternal.h
- SECTOR_SIZE : dfsinternal.h
- set_AI_interrupt() : interrupt.c, interrupt.h
- set_CART_interrupt() : interrupt.c, interrupt.h
- set_DP_interrupt() : interrupt.c, interrupt.h
- set_PI_interrupt() : interrupt.c, interrupt.h
- set_RESET_interrupt() : interrupt.h, interrupt.c
- set_SI_interrupt() : interrupt.c, interrupt.h
- set_SP_interrupt() : interrupt.c, interrupt.h
- set_TI_interrupt() : interrupt.c, interrupt.h
- set_VI_interrupt() : interrupt.c, interrupt.h
- SGB_ENHANCED : tpak.h
- SGB_NOT_ENHANCED : tpak.h
- sgb_support_type : tpak.h
- SI_callback : interrupt.c
- SI_CLEAR_INTERRUPT : interrupt.c
- SI_STATUS_DMA_BUSY : joybus.c
- SI_STATUS_IO_BUSY : joybus.c
- SOM_AA_ENABLE : rdpq_macros.h
- SOM_ALPHACOMPARE_MASK : rdpq_macros.h
- SOM_ALPHACOMPARE_NOISE : rdpq_macros.h
- SOM_ALPHACOMPARE_NONE : rdpq_macros.h
- SOM_ALPHACOMPARE_SHIFT : rdpq_macros.h
- SOM_ALPHACOMPARE_THRESHOLD : rdpq_macros.h
- SOM_ALPHADITHER_INVERT : rdpq_macros.h
- SOM_ALPHADITHER_MASK : rdpq_macros.h
- SOM_ALPHADITHER_NOISE : rdpq_macros.h
- SOM_ALPHADITHER_NONE : rdpq_macros.h
- SOM_ALPHADITHER_SAME : rdpq_macros.h
- SOM_ALPHADITHER_SHIFT : rdpq_macros.h
- SOM_ATOMIC_PRIM : rdpq_macros.h
- SOM_BLALPHA_CC : rdpq_macros.h
- SOM_BLALPHA_CVG : rdpq_macros.h
- SOM_BLALPHA_CVG_TIMES_CC : rdpq_macros.h
- SOM_BLALPHA_MASK : rdpq_macros.h
- SOM_BLALPHA_SHIFT : rdpq_macros.h
- SOM_BLEND0_MASK : rdpq_macros.h
- SOM_BLEND1_MASK : rdpq_macros.h
- SOM_BLEND_MASK : rdpq_macros.h
- SOM_BLENDING : rdpq_macros.h
- SOM_COLOR_ON_CVG_OVERFLOW : rdpq_macros.h
- SOM_COVERAGE_DEST_CLAMP : rdpq_macros.h
- SOM_COVERAGE_DEST_MASK : rdpq_macros.h
- SOM_COVERAGE_DEST_SAVE : rdpq_macros.h
- SOM_COVERAGE_DEST_SHIFT : rdpq_macros.h
- SOM_COVERAGE_DEST_WRAP : rdpq_macros.h
- SOM_COVERAGE_DEST_ZAP : rdpq_macros.h
- SOM_CYCLE_1 : rdpq_macros.h
- SOM_CYCLE_2 : rdpq_macros.h
- SOM_CYCLE_COPY : rdpq_macros.h
- SOM_CYCLE_FILL : rdpq_macros.h
- SOM_CYCLE_MASK : rdpq_macros.h
- SOM_CYCLE_SHIFT : rdpq_macros.h
- SOM_READ_ENABLE : rdpq_macros.h
- SOM_RGBDITHER_BAYER : rdpq_macros.h
- SOM_RGBDITHER_MASK : rdpq_macros.h
- SOM_RGBDITHER_NOISE : rdpq_macros.h
- SOM_RGBDITHER_NONE : rdpq_macros.h
- SOM_RGBDITHER_SHIFT : rdpq_macros.h
- SOM_RGBDITHER_SQUARE : rdpq_macros.h
- SOM_SAMPLE_BILINEAR : rdpq_macros.h
- SOM_SAMPLE_MASK : rdpq_macros.h
- SOM_SAMPLE_MEDIAN : rdpq_macros.h
- SOM_SAMPLE_POINT : rdpq_macros.h
- SOM_SAMPLE_SHIFT : rdpq_macros.h
- SOM_TEXTURE_DETAIL : rdpq_macros.h
- SOM_TEXTURE_LOD : rdpq_macros.h
- SOM_TEXTURE_LOD_SHIFT : rdpq_macros.h
- SOM_TEXTURE_PERSP : rdpq_macros.h
- SOM_TEXTURE_SHARPEN : rdpq_macros.h
- SOM_TF0_RGB : rdpq_macros.h
- SOM_TF0_YUV : rdpq_macros.h
- SOM_TF1_RGB : rdpq_macros.h
- SOM_TF1_YUV : rdpq_macros.h
- SOM_TF1_YUVTEX0 : rdpq_macros.h
- SOM_TF_MASK : rdpq_macros.h
- SOM_TF_SHIFT : rdpq_macros.h
- SOM_TLUT_IA16 : rdpq_macros.h
- SOM_TLUT_MASK : rdpq_macros.h
- SOM_TLUT_NONE : rdpq_macros.h
- SOM_TLUT_RGBA16 : rdpq_macros.h
- SOM_TLUT_SHIFT : rdpq_macros.h
- SOM_Z_COMPARE : rdpq_macros.h
- SOM_Z_COMPARE_SHIFT : rdpq_macros.h
- SOM_Z_WRITE : rdpq_macros.h
- SOM_Z_WRITE_SHIFT : rdpq_macros.h
- SOM_ZMODE_DECAL : rdpq_macros.h
- SOM_ZMODE_INTERPENETRATING : rdpq_macros.h
- SOM_ZMODE_MASK : rdpq_macros.h
- SOM_ZMODE_OPAQUE : rdpq_macros.h
- SOM_ZMODE_SHIFT : rdpq_macros.h
- SOM_ZMODE_TRANSPARENT : rdpq_macros.h
- SOM_ZSOURCE_MASK : rdpq_macros.h
- SOM_ZSOURCE_PIXEL : rdpq_macros.h
- SOM_ZSOURCE_PRIM : rdpq_macros.h
- SOM_ZSOURCE_SHIFT : rdpq_macros.h
- SOMX_AA_REDUCED : rdpq_macros.h
- SOMX_BLEND_2PASS : rdpq_macros.h
- SOMX_FOG : rdpq_macros.h
- SOMX_LOD_INTERPOLATE : rdpq_macros.h
- SOMX_NUMLODS_MASK : rdpq_macros.h
- SOMX_NUMLODS_SHIFT : rdpq_macros.h
- SOMX_UPDATE_FREEZE : rdpq_macros.h
- SP_callback : interrupt.c
- SP_CLEAR_INTERRUPT : interrupt.c
- SP_DMA_BUSY : rsp.h
- SP_DMA_FULL : rsp.h
- SP_DMA_RAMADDR : rsp.h
- SP_DMA_RDLEN : rsp.h
- SP_DMA_SPADDR : rsp.h
- SP_DMA_WRLEN : rsp.h
- SP_DMEM : rsp.h
- SP_IMEM : rsp.h
- SP_PC : rsp.h
- SP_SEMAPHORE : rsp.h
- SP_STATUS : rsp.h
- SP_STATUS_BROKE : rsp.h
- SP_STATUS_DMA_BUSY : rsp.h
- SP_STATUS_DMA_FULL : rsp.h
- SP_STATUS_HALTED : rsp.h
- SP_STATUS_INTERRUPT_ON_BREAK : rsp.h
- SP_STATUS_IO_BUSY : rsp.h
- SP_STATUS_SIG0 : rsp.h
- SP_STATUS_SIG1 : rsp.h
- SP_STATUS_SIG2 : rsp.h
- SP_STATUS_SIG3 : rsp.h
- SP_STATUS_SIG4 : rsp.h
- SP_STATUS_SIG5 : rsp.h
- SP_STATUS_SIG6 : rsp.h
- SP_STATUS_SIG7 : rsp.h
- SP_STATUS_SSTEP : rsp.h
- SP_WSTATUS_CLEAR_BROKE : rsp.h
- SP_WSTATUS_CLEAR_HALT : rsp.h
- SP_WSTATUS_CLEAR_INTR : rsp.h
- SP_WSTATUS_CLEAR_INTR_BREAK : rsp.h
- SP_WSTATUS_CLEAR_SIG0 : rsp.h
- SP_WSTATUS_CLEAR_SIG1 : rsp.h
- SP_WSTATUS_CLEAR_SIG2 : rsp.h
- SP_WSTATUS_CLEAR_SIG3 : rsp.h
- SP_WSTATUS_CLEAR_SIG4 : rsp.h
- SP_WSTATUS_CLEAR_SIG5 : rsp.h
- SP_WSTATUS_CLEAR_SIG6 : rsp.h
- SP_WSTATUS_CLEAR_SIG7 : rsp.h
- SP_WSTATUS_CLEAR_SSTEP : rsp.h
- SP_WSTATUS_SET_HALT : rsp.h
- SP_WSTATUS_SET_INTR : rsp.h
- SP_WSTATUS_SET_INTR_BREAK : rsp.h
- SP_WSTATUS_SET_SIG0 : rsp.h
- SP_WSTATUS_SET_SIG1 : rsp.h
- SP_WSTATUS_SET_SIG2 : rsp.h
- SP_WSTATUS_SET_SIG3 : rsp.h
- SP_WSTATUS_SET_SIG4 : rsp.h
- SP_WSTATUS_SET_SIG5 : rsp.h
- SP_WSTATUS_SET_SIG6 : rsp.h
- SP_WSTATUS_SET_SIG7 : rsp.h
- SP_WSTATUS_SET_SSTEP : rsp.h
- sprite_fits_tmem() : sprite.h
- SPRITE_FLAGS_EXT : sprite.h
- SPRITE_FLAGS_OWNEDBUFFER : sprite.h
- SPRITE_FLAGS_TEXFORMAT : sprite.h
- sprite_free() : sprite.h
- sprite_get_detail_pixels() : sprite.h
- sprite_get_format() : sprite.h
- sprite_get_lod_count() : sprite.h
- sprite_get_lod_pixels() : sprite.h
- sprite_get_palette() : sprite.h
- sprite_get_pixels() : sprite.h
- sprite_get_texparms() : sprite.h
- sprite_get_tile() : sprite.h
- sprite_load() : sprite.h
- sprite_load_buf() : sprite.h
- STACK_SIZE : system.c
- start_timer() : timer.c, timer.h
- start_timer_context() : timer.c, timer.h
- stat() : system.c
- STDERR_FILENO : system.c
- STDIN_FILENO : system.c
- STDOUT_FILENO : system.c
- stop_timer() : timer.c, timer.h
- surface_alloc() : surface.c, surface.h
- SURFACE_FLAGS_OWNEDBUFFER : surface.h
- SURFACE_FLAGS_TEXFORMAT : surface.h
- SURFACE_FLAGS_TEXINDEX : surface.h
- surface_free() : surface.c, surface.h
- surface_get_format() : surface.c, surface.h
- surface_get_placeholder_index() : surface.h
- surface_has_owned_buffer() : surface.h, surface.c
- surface_make() : surface.c, surface.h
- surface_make_linear() : surface.c, surface.h
- surface_make_placeholder() : surface.h
- surface_make_placeholder_linear() : surface.h
- surface_make_sub() : surface.c, surface.h
- symlink() : system.c
- sys_bbplayer() : n64sys.h
- sys_reset_type() : n64sys.c, n64sys.h
- syscall_handler_t : exception.h